What is a Dialer?
An automated dialer is a call center software tool that automatically dials numbers from a pre-loaded list. When a customer answers, the call is either connected to a live agent or plays a pre-recorded message. Dialers help businesses save time, reduce manual dialing errors, and increase the number of successful customer connections for sales, support, or follow-ups.
How Dialers Work
- Pre-Loaded List: Numbers are uploaded or integrated from a CRM or customer database.
- Automated Dialing: The dialer system calls numbers sequentially or based on selected rules.
- Call Handling: If a call is answered, it is routed to an available agent or triggers a recorded message. Unanswered calls, busy lines, or voicemails are logged for future attempts.
- Data Tracking: The dialer tracks outcomes like successful connections, missed calls, or voicemails for reporting and performance analysis.
